Electronic level sensing drain: Highest reliability. Exceptional payback.

Electronic capacity level-controlled principle is the gold standard for condensate drains. Unlike drains that use floaters, there are minimum moving parts, hence no wear & tear, no alignment issues and no requirement for frequent maintenance to ensure functionality. Since drainage takes place only when required, there is no loss of expensive compressed air; payback is usually a matter of months.

Dirt & Chemical Insulated Valve System

Condensate is inherently corrosive and contains dirt, pipe scale and other impurities. A pilot air controlled membrane valve, where only the diaphragm contacts discharge, provides superior reliability.

The inert HNBR diaphragm provides chemical resistance. An air lock-proof strainer insulates valve from dirt..

Continuous & Undisrupted Operation

Alarm with Auto-Recovery & Test Functions

The electronic system features an intelligent alarm that constantly monitors operation. When condensate is not discharged, the drain automatically goes into an alarm mode to clear blockage. A remote alarm connection is provided.

A test function allows for easy checks on functionality. The digital counting indicator is an option that enhances user control.

Rugged Construction & Operational Flexibility

Our generously sized housing with large internal flow paths allows smooth discharge of condensate. Aluminium construction with internal hard-coat, our housings have a long design life.

Durability in extreme humid conditions and fluctuating temperatures is assured with a true IP65 electronic enclosure. Free voltage and dual frequency capabilities provide operational flexibility.
